Introduction

1. Présentation de Aurore ERP

Aurore ERP est une solution technologique conçue pour la digitalisation des processus de gestion d’entreprise, notamment la facturation, en s’appuyant sur des retours d’expérience issus de phases expérimentales.

Flexible et configurable selon l’organisation, elle propose une forte adaptabilité et une mise en œuvre rapide.

Modules fonctionnels principaux :

  • Gestion commerciale : clients, fournisseurs, devis, facturation, bons de commande
  • Comptabilité & finance : écritures comptables, bilans, TVA, rapprochements bancaires
  • Gestion des stocks : entrées/sorties, inventaires, approvisionnement
  • Ressources humaines : paie, congés, contrats, gestion des employés
  • Production : planification, suivi des ordres de fabrication, gestion des ressources
  • Modules complémentaires :
    • Dashboard
    • Transferts inter-agences
    • Gestion des règlements

2. Architecture de Déploiement On-Premise

a) Composants principaux

Aurore ERP est disponible sous forme d’un installateur local (on-premise) basé sur des technologies web.

Ce mode permet à plusieurs utilisateurs de se connecter simultanément à l’application.

NB : Tous les utilisateurs doivent être connectés au même réseau que le serveur hébergeant l’application.


b) Composants fonctionnels

Le système repose sur les éléments suivants :

  • Serveur d’application
    Machine principale sur laquelle l’application est installée
  • Serveur de base de données
    Héberge la base de données locale de l’application
  • Serveur de messagerie (optionnel)
    Utilisé pour l’envoi de SMS (service externe intégré)

c) Public cible

Ce manuel s’adresse aux :

  • Administrateurs systèmes
  • Ingénieurs DevOps
  • Techniciens IT

Compétences requises :

  • Systèmes d’exploitation : Windows, Windows Server
  • Bases de données : SQL Server
  • Réseaux et sécurité : configuration firewall, gestion des accès

d) Objectifs du déploiement

Le déploiement de Aurore ERP vise à :

  • Assurer une installation stable et sécurisée
  • Configurer correctement la base de données et le réseau
  • Optimiser les performances et la scalabilité
  • Garantir une intégration fluide avec les systèmes existants
  • Mettre en place une procédure claire de maintenance et de mise à jour

e) Conditions et contraintes

Avant toute installation, il est important de considérer :

  • Compatibilité
    Vérifier la compatibilité avec le système d’exploitation et SQL Server
  • Sécurité
    Mettre en place des accès sécurisés avec des permissions adaptées
  • Ressources matérielles
    Disposer d’une machine serveur adaptée à la charge d’utilisation

f) Configuration matérielle recommandée

Pour un fonctionnement optimal :

  • Machine serveur (recommandé : Dell)
  • Système : Windows 10 / Windows Server
  • Processeur : Intel Core i5 ou supérieur
  • Mémoire : 8 Go RAM minimum

Le serveur héberge l’application web, accessible aux utilisateurs du réseau.


g) Logiciels nécessaires

  • Navigateur web
    Accès à l’application via IP + port configuré
    (Chrome, Edge, Firefox, Opera, etc.)
  • Serveur de base de données
    Microsoft SQL Server
  • Gestionnaire de services
    Pour configurer le démarrage automatique des services
  • Invite de commande (CMD)
    Pour démarrer/arrêter les services en mode administrateur